Dedicated care, in a dedicated clinic

ClaraSana Women's Health clinic is held during specific time slots within Brighton Beach Medical Centre each week and is exclusively for perimenopause and menopause consultations. This protected time allows for longer, focused appointments where hormonal change and menopause is the only priority.

General GP appointments are provided at other times during the week through Dr Susana's regular GP clinic. This means:

  • You receive dedicated menopause-focused care

  • Consultations are never rushed or mixed with unrelated concerns

  • You still have the option of ongoing GP care if you wish
